HELP- should I take Feb LSAT for this cycle??

Post by hannah87 » Fri Jan 15, 2010 2:44 pm

Today's the deadline to register. I have a 3.9/168 (took for the first time in December), but really want NYU. I am not a URM, and don't have any spectacular softs, so I don't think I have great chances. I expect a waitlist. What do you think about trying the Feb LSAT in the hopes of getting a waitlist from NYU and being able to send them a better score? Is it worth the pressure/risk of getting an even lower score? I'm so torn...

Any insight would be much appreciated.

Re: HELP- should I take Feb LSAT for this cycle??

Post by cr073137 » Fri Jan 15, 2010 3:00 pm

I am also doing the same approach, but I spoke with the dean of Columbia and they WILL NOT take your Feb LSAT. Harvard does "considers" your application in light of new information, but most schools that have deadlines before the release of the Feb score will not take it, the policy is different at each school, so I would say to call and find out because it might not be worth it to take it again.

Re: HELP- should I take Feb LSAT for this cycle??

Post by hannah87 » Fri Jan 15, 2010 3:13 pm

Spoke to NYU admissions office...they said that if the February score is received before my application is reviewed, they will likely consider it and average it with my December score (they would discount the December score only with a convincing addendum as to why it was lower).

I don't think I'll score higher than a 171/172, so I don't think it's worth it to take it again. Oh well. I hope this info helps others decide...
